NY C88264 July 15, 1998 CLA-2-29:RR:NC:2:240 C88264 CATEGORY: Classification TARIFF NO.: 2909.60.5000 Mr. Joseph J. Chivini Austin Chemical Company, Inc. 1565 Barclay Boulevard Buffalo Grove, Illinois 6089-4537 RE: The tariff classification of 1,1-Bis (tert-butylperoxy)- 3,3,5-trimethyl cyclohexane, CAS 6731-36-8 from Japan Dear Mr. Chivini: In your letter dated May 1, 1998 you requested a tariff classification ruling. The applicable subheading for 1,1-Bis (tert-butylperoxy)- 3,3,5-trimethyl cyclohexane, CAS 6731-36-8 will be 2909.60.5000,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for Ether peroxides: Other. The rate of duty will be 3.7 percent ad valorem This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Part 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177). A copy of the ruling or the control number indicated above should be provided with the entry documents filed at the time this merchandise is imported.
